26 changes: 17 additions & 9 deletions deploy/python/visualize.py
Original file line number Diff line number Diff line change
Expand Up @@ -19,18 +19,21 @@
import math
import numpy as np
import PIL
from PIL import Image, ImageDraw, ImageFile
from PIL import Image, ImageDraw, ImageFile, ImageFont
ImageFile.LOAD_TRUNCATED_IMAGES = True

def imagedraw_textsize_c(draw, text):
from ppdet.utils.download import get_path


def imagedraw_textsize_c(draw, text, font=None):
if int(PIL.__version__.split('.')[0]) < 10:
tw, th = draw.textsize(text)
tw, th = draw.textsize(text, font=font)
else:
left, top, right, bottom = draw.textbbox((0, 0), text)
left, top, right, bottom = draw.textbbox((0, 0), text, font=font)
tw, th = right - left, bottom - top

return tw, th
